Boilers in a house built decades back have often seen more than one round of parts replacements, and what failed last is rarely what is failing now. Half the homes in Wheeler County, Georgia were built in 1987 or earlier (2020-2024 ACS 5-year). When a contractor opens a boiler in stock like this, the question that decides the job is whether the replacement parts the system takes are still manufactured and available, not whether the repair itself is straightforward. A heat exchanger or a gas valve for a system that old can be difficult to source, and that gap between what the boiler needs and what the supply chain carries is where a repair quote either holds or falls apart.

The Parts of a Boiler a Contractor Checks First

Isometric cutaway illustration of a single-story house showing a boiler with a flue pipe through the roof and orange pipes connecting radiators in several rooms.

The boiler itself sits in the basement or utility room and is the piece a contractor goes to first. It heats water and pushes it out to the rest of the house. When heat stops coming up or pressure drops unexpectedly, the boiler's burner, heat exchanger, or pressure relief valve is usually where the problem lives.

From the boiler, pipes carry hot water to radiators or baseboard units positioned along the walls of each room, and a circulator pump keeps that water moving through the loop. When a room runs cold while others stay warm, the contractor checks the circulator and any zone valves that control which sections of pipe receive flow.
